Please use this identifier to cite or link to this item: http://dspace.sti.ufcg.edu.br:8080/jspui/handle/riufcg/25017
Title: NodeGIS: simplificando o desenvolvimento de aplicações web de geoprocessamento.
Other Titles: NodeGIS: simplifying the development of geoprocessing web applications.
???metadata.dc.creator???: CUNHA, Mateus Queiroz.
???metadata.dc.contributor.advisor1???: BAPTISTA, Cláudio de Souza.
???metadata.dc.contributor.referee1???: GARCIA, Francilene Procópio.
???metadata.dc.contributor.referee2???: MASSONI, Tiago Lima.
Keywords: Sistemas de informações geográficas web;Geoprocessamento;Aplicações web;Web GIS;Conteinerização;REST – Representational State Transfer;Web geographic information systems;Geoprocessing;Web Applications;Web GIS;Containerization;REST – Representational State Transfer
Issue Date: 20-Oct-2021
Publisher: Universidade Federal de Campina Grande
Citation: CUNHA, Mateus Queiroz. NodeGIS: simplificando o desenvolvimento de aplicações web de geoprocessamento. 2021. 14f. Trabalho de Conclusão de Curso (Artigo), Centro de Engenharia Elétrica e Informática, Universidade Federal de Campina Grande - Paraíba - Brasil, 2021. Disponível em: http://dspace.sti.ufcg.edu.br:8080/jspui/handle/riufcg/25017
???metadata.dc.description.resumo???: Diante da vasta presença da informação espacial nas aplicações atuais, surgiram várias ferramentas que fomentam o desenvolvimento de aplicações web de Sistemas de Informações Geográficas (GIS). Apesar de haver um grande número de soluções, muitas são complexas, requerendo habilidades específicas dos desenvolvedores. Portanto, há a necessidade de uma ferramenta que simplifique o processo de desenvolver e publicar uma aplicação web GIS, com a vantagem de ser de código aberto. Neste trabalho é apresentado o NodeGIS, uma ferramenta de código aberto que provê uma interface gráfica para o desenvolvimento de aplicações de web GIS, sem escrita de código ou configuração complexa de servidores. O NodeGIS utiliza-se de uma arquitetura baseada em contêineres, fazendo uso de REST, e facilitando o deployment de uma aplicação web GIS. A ferramenta apresentada permite ao usuário plotar mapas vetoriais, realizar operações de overlay e de personalização de camadas, zooming, panning, tooltip, consultas em atributos convencionais e espaciais. O NodeGIS também pode ser utilizado no ensino de GIS, não necessitando instalação de software por parte dos alunos.
Abstract: Associated with the ubiquity of spatial information nowadays, several tools which foster the development of web Geographical Information Systems (GIS) have emerged. Although there are a large number of solutions, many are complex, requiring specific skills from developers. Therefore, there is a need for a tool that simplifies the process of developing and publishing a web GIS application, with the advantage of being open source. In our study, we present NodeGIS, an open source tool that provides a graphical interface for the development of web GIS applications, without code writing or complex server configuration. NodeGIS uses a container-based architecture, using REST and facilitating the deployment of a web GIS application. The presented tool allows the user to plot vector maps, perform overlay and customization operations, zooming, panning, tooltip, conventional and spatial attribute queries. NodeGIS can also be used for teaching GIS, requiring no software installation from students.
Keywords: Sistemas de informações geográficas web
Geoprocessamento
Aplicações web
Web GIS
Conteinerização
REST – Representational State Transfer
Web geographic information systems
Geoprocessing
Web Applications
Web GIS
Containerization
REST – Representational State Transfer
URI: http://dspace.sti.ufcg.edu.br:8080/jspui/handle/riufcg/25017
Appears in Collections:Trabalho de Conclusão de Curso - Artigo - Ciência da Computação

Files in This Item:
File Description SizeFormat 
MATEUS QUEIROZ CUNHA - TCC ARTIGO CIÊNCIA DA COMPUTAÇÃO 2021.pdfMateus Queiroz Cunha -TCC Artigo Ciência da Computação 2021.2.85 MBAdobe PDFView/Open


Items in DSpace are protected by copyright, with all rights reserved, unless otherwise indicated.